WebAug 23, 2024 · numpy.apply_along_axis. ¶. Apply a function to 1-D slices along the given axis. Execute func1d (a, *args) where func1d operates on 1-D arrays and a is a 1-D slice of arr along axis. Webcupy.concatenate# cupy. concatenate (tup, axis = 0, out = None, *, dtype = None, casting = 'same_kind') [source] # Joins arrays along an axis.
